Remember, the formula of a square is [tex]s^{2}[/tex]. If I half x, [tex](x/2)^{2}[/tex] is the new formula. Because the exponent is around the varialbe(x/2), both are squares. Therefore, the formula is [tex]x^{2} \divide 4[/tex].
Therefore, the new area is B: a quarter of the original.
